What Ingredients Should You Look for in a Face Mask for Airbrushing?

  • Hyaluronic Acid: This powerful humectant attracts moisture to the skin, providing hydration and plumpness, which is essential for achieving a smooth base for airbrushing.
  • Glycerin: Known for its moisturizing properties, glycerin helps to soften the skin and create a barrier that locks in moisture, making it easier for makeup to adhere without looking cakey.
  • Niacinamide: This form of Vitamin B3 helps to improve the skin’s barrier function, reduce redness, and even out skin tone, which can enhance the finish of airbrushed makeup.
  • Salicylic Acid: Particularly beneficial for oily or acne-prone skin, salicylic acid helps to exfoliate and clear pores, ensuring a smoother surface for airbrushing while also preventing breakouts.
  • Antioxidants (like Vitamin C): These ingredients protect the skin from free radical damage and help brighten the complexion, creating a radiant and youthful glow that is perfect for airbrushed looks.
  • Clay or Charcoal: These ingredients are excellent for detoxifying and purifying the skin, absorbing excess oil and impurities, which can help your airbrushed makeup last longer and look fresher.
  • Peptides: Peptides support skin repair and collagen production, enhancing skin elasticity and firmness, which contribute to a more flawless airbrushed finish.
  • Silicone-based Ingredients: Silicones create a smooth and even surface on the skin, allowing airbrush makeup to glide on effortlessly and helping to blur imperfections for a polished look.

What Key Features Should You Consider When Choosing a Face Mask for Airbrushing?

When selecting the best face mask for airbrushing, several key features should be considered to ensure optimal performance and comfort.

  • Material: The material of the face mask plays a crucial role in its effectiveness and comfort. Look for masks made from breathable fabrics that can prevent moisture buildup while providing adequate filtration without being too restrictive.
  • Fit: A proper fit is essential for both comfort and effectiveness. Masks should contour to the face without gaps, ensuring that air and particles do not escape around the edges, which is especially important during airbrushing applications.
  • Filtration Efficiency: The filtration efficiency of a mask indicates how well it can block out harmful particles. Masks with a higher filtration rating, such as N95 or similar, are preferable as they can prevent fine pigments and chemicals from being inhaled during airbrushing.
  • Adjustability: Masks with adjustable straps or nose pieces can enhance comfort and create a better seal. This feature allows the user to customize the fit based on their facial structure, which is beneficial for long periods of use.
  • Reusability: Consider whether the mask is designed for single-use or if it can be washed and reused. Reusable masks can be more cost-effective over time and are often made from durable materials that can withstand regular cleaning.
  • Breathability: Airflow is vital when wearing a mask for extended periods, especially during airbrushing. Masks that incorporate ventilation features or are made of lightweight materials will help maintain comfort and reduce fatigue.
  • Compatibility with Airbrush Equipment: Some masks may be specifically tailored to work alongside airbrushing tools. Ensure the mask does not interfere with the airbrush application itself or restrict visibility and movement during the process.
